Talking about attitudes to the ideal family

Read and translate this text and put three questions to it:

If a perfect family were to exist, what would they be like?

This is my first time ever thinking of such a question. Yes, what would a perfect family be like? Would they be a wholesome stereotypical American family, ready with a freshly baked pie to bring over? Families play a very large role in molding each other throughout the years and creating this personality within one another that affect also other people outside of the family. The world is filled with many problematic families and there are kids out there dreaming for a perfect family to pop into their lives and that is what we are to discuss. A perfect family, what is that? To me, an ideal family should be composed of a kind mother, a hardworking father and supportive siblings.

A mother, as I have always seen it, should be kind and not because this would benefit the kids in taking advantage of a let loose mother but because a kind mother would definitely help in proper child growth. My mother is definitely what others would perceive as kind and caring, but only when she wants to be. She’s always there like how any other compassionate mother should be, giving me good advice, cooking good food and most of all, telling me how much she loves me every day with a hug and a kiss. Sure, she may be hot headed; strict since she’s a business teacher and arrogant but trading her for my “ideal” mother would be wrong. My mother is wonderful being just the way she is, never prying too much into my social life and loving me for being myself like how a good mother should be.

Secondly, a hardworking father who always does his best to provide for the family while at the same time tries to spend as many hours with them as possible. This is truly an ideal father for me, never too forceful towards his kids, calm, loving and with a strong build in both mind and body.

To sum up I think in my ideal family there can be on the one hand good times and on the other hand bad times. But that is not the fault of this type of family, that’s just how life is. In every type of family there are good and bad times.

Activity One of the main problems of family life is the relationship between young people and their parents. State your position on one of the following set of questions:

1. When do usually young people move out of their parents’ home and start living in their own place?

2. What are the advantages of living with parents? What are the disadvantages?

3. Should young adults live with their parents until they get married? Why or why not?

4. In many countries young married couples live with their in-laws after marriage. Is this good? Why or why not?

Here are some typical phrases you can use:

  • It is often suggested / believed that …

  • A lot of people think that …

  • Some people are against …

  • Many people are convinced that ….

  • I think / I believe / I consider that…

  • Some opponents of… might argue / contend that… 

  • They assume / suppose…

  • I don’t share the above given view…

  • To my mind… / In my opinion… / It seems to me that…

  • I am against… / I don’t approve of… / I don’t support the idea of… / I personally frown on… 

  • I agree/ disagree…

  • It is said / believed that…

  • It goes without saying that…

  • To sum up, … 

  • To conclude, I would argue that… 

  • On this basis, I can conclude that... 

  • In conclusion, I would like to stress that… 

  • All in all, I believe that….
